  1. anomic aphasia

    Anomic aphasia, also known as nominal aphasia, is a type of language disorder that affects an individual's ability to recall names of everyday objects. The person knows and understands what an object is used for and may be able to describe it in detail, but they cannot remember the name of the object itself. This condition is usually caused by brain damage to areas involved in language production, such as damage from strokes or tumors. It can also be a feature of neurodegenerative diseases like Alzheimer's disease or dementia. Anomic aphasia can interfere with an individual's ability to communicate effectively.
